Transaction e543edbcb93a67f13053d51ceef7bd650b682ed1fc3c0b90d247790b620baf50
1 Input
-
88346e6664b20d66a8d18a6ee1f02c77123aa8327ef90c1e08281501fbd2caa8:1
OP_DATA_48(48) 44022042d592cb7667d2455c7b0783ea0acab8d4f766bf826daac330fe475a08e2997c022036eafdea79afe9dea9c20b
1 Outputs
- e543edbcb93a67f13053d51ceef7bd650b682ed1fc3c0b90d247790b620baf50:0
value 1414690
address 32fXVozYmG9nb2sEMm5JnhxVPRCTLELysw